Abstract

PURPOSE:To make a mirror light weight and to improve its mechanical and thermal characteristics by constituting a base plate of carbon reinforced with carbon fiber impregnated with glass. CONSTITUTION:A material 2 for the surface of a glass mirror is bonded to one side surface of a base plate 1 comprising carbon fiber reinforced carbon impregnated with glass, and a metal coating layer 3 is built thereon if necessary. It is preferred that the material 2 consists of low heat-expansive Ti silicate glass or quartz glass, etc. having -1.5-68X10<-7>/ deg.C coefft. of thermal expansion. The material for the base plate 1 is preferred to be one among PAN fiber, pitch fiber, and rayon fiber compounded with carbon matrix, into which glass is impregnated and the carbon fiber is oriented in >=2 directions in the matrix. Further, the layer 3 is preferred to be constituted of Au, Al, Mo, Cu, or alloy thereof.
